  • Moving only part of iphoto library to external hard drive

    I would like to only move part of my iphoto library to an external hard drive.  Trying to archive my older pictures.  I know how to move the entire library but not so sure on how to move only parts of the library.  Do i need to create a second archived library and move the pictures I want to archive to that archived libary and then move the archived libary to an external hard drive?

    Here's one way to do it:
    Make sure the drive is formatted Mac OS Extended (Journaled)
    1. Quit iPhoto
    2. Copy the iPhoto Library from your Pictures Folder to the External Disk.
    Now you have two full versions of the Library.
    3. On the Internal library, trash the Events you don't want there
    Now you have a full copy of the Library on the External and a smaller subset on the Internal
    Some Notes:
    As a general rule: when deleting photos do them in batches of about 100 at a time. iPhoto can baulk at trashing large numbers at one go.
    You can choose which Library to open: Hold down the option (or alt) key key and launch iPhoto. From the resulting menu select 'Choose Library'
    You can keep the Library on the external updated with new imports using iPhoto Library Manager

  • Need to move (consolidate) my iTunes files (media/library) from my external hard drive (i use time capsule as an ext hd)  back to my main iMac where my iTunes is located.

    I used my time capsule (1st gen) as an external hard drive to store my iTunes files and my iTunes app is on my main iMac.  Now, I've decided to move those iTunes files from my external hard drive (TC) back to my iMac where my iTunes app is located.  What is the best way to do this?

    Is the Time Capsule the right piece of kit for the job?
    Not really, no.
    TC is a dumb as board hard disk in an airport extreme router. It has no media servers.. no backup.. it is slow and designed for TM target for laptops. The major one here is lack of backup. Any files you put on the TC can and will be lost at some point.. and to backup you need to have a computer connected to it with an external hard disk.. and a 3rd party backup because TM is too dumb to back up network drives.
    TC is designed to spin up slow and spin down quickly at the end of backup. You will have issues when you stream media from it.
    ATV needs to connect to itunes server.. not the library. You will still need a computer running. Same for lots of things.. since apple designed their system to be dependent on itunes.
    The best idea is a media computer.. a mac mini is ideal. Don't need the latest greatest.. but an actual mac running itunes. Unfortunately it doesn't have large internal drives.. so it is still a bit kludgy in needing a fast external drive.. but at least you have automatic backups.

  • What 1Tb external hard drive should I be considering for my new 27 in iMac.

    I'm going to be purchasing a new 27in iMac soon. I have begun searching online reviews for a 1TB external hard drive. I may have narrowed the search down to OWC Mercury Elite and G Technolgyand maybe LaCie. Any help would be appreciated.

    I'll second the recommendation for OWC (macsales.com); I also have a couple of LaCie's - there is nothing wrong, but I do prefer the Mercury Elite.
    FWIW, most external hard drives come with some sort of software - there is absolutely no need for it. I plug in a new hard drive, wait until I see the icon on the desktop, launch Disk Utility and partition/format the drive to Mac OS Extended (Journaled) and (under options) GUID partition scheme. At that point, you can decide to have one or more partitions on it depending on what you want to use it for. In any case, that process will wipe the drive clean - when finished, the new hard drive will be ready for whatever you want to use it for.

  • Why does my I Tunes play only some of my library when it can't access the external hard drive from which I imported some of the music? My esternal hard drive has been corrupted, but I    thought I Tunes would have "saved" songs I dragged to it.

    Some of my ITunes library came from CDs, some from an external hard drive with songs  in it.  My external hard drive went bad, which I wouln't have thought would have affected my Itunes library or the songs I had previously imported to it from the external drive.  But now the Itunes cannot locate many of those songs. Is there some process of importing/saving that is different when you import from CD? Hope someone can help.....MN

    Hi MNinPungo,
    When adding music to iTunes from another location (for example, an external hard drive), iTunes can either make a local copy of the file in the iTunes Library or create a pointer to the original file in the original location, depending on the preferences you have set. You may find the following article helpful:
    Add to Library
    So you can access content quickly, iTunes indexes all music, audio book, and video files that you add to iTunes. This index is called the iTunes library. When you add content to the library, iTunes adds an entry for each audio or movie file to your index. The files could be in your Home folder, somewhere else on your hard drive, on an external hard disk, or on another computer that you're accessing through file sharing.
    To add files to your iTunes library, you can use these options:
    Drag files from the Finder to the appropriate icon on the left side of the iTunes window.
    Choose File > Add to Library (on Windows, choose Add File to Library or Add Folder to Library) and select the song or folder that you want to add.
    iTunes adds entries to your iTunes library for the selected files and copies the files to your iTunes Music folder (if you selected that option in the Advanced pane of iTunes preferences).

  • Disconnecting external hard drive error - PLS HELP!

    im an iMac newbie so i didnt know i was gonna encounter a problem when i manually disconnected my external hard drive from the USB port. when i disconnected it, an error message popped up saying something like the USB device was not properly disconnected..make sure to eject the device... this may cause loss of data, etc. So when i tried to plug in my external hard drive again, a message box popped up saying something like "the device is not compatible with this computer.." so i went and tried to connect the external hard drive on to my PC... as i expected, an error message popped up saying that it is not formatted yet and it was asking me if i want to reformat it..
    what should i do??? did i permanently lose all the data in my external hard drive?? is there any way to restore the files?? please help..

    As indicated in the previous post, you need to 'eject' the drive before you disconnect the cable or power down the external drive.
    to eject:
    click on the drive icon then press command-e
    right click or control click on the drive icon then select eject
    plus other methods
    I'd plug in the device & power up the device before starting the mac. This will force a drive check.
    With the device connected & power up, then run disk repair.
    harddrive > applications > utilities > Disk Utility
    On the left you will see a list of devices with the partitions on the device below the device icon. Select the device icon of the external device. Be sure to select the device not the partition on the device.
    Select the First Aid tab. See lower right.
    run verify
    run repair
    run verify
    what should i do??? did i permanently lose all the data > in my external hard drive?? is there any way to restore > the files?? please help..
    If the repair doesn't work you need to try a utility like disk warrior. If that dosn't work, you will need to try a commercial recovery firm.

    What is it you are trying to do? Do you want to change the backup drive from the one you have been using to another drive? That's all you can do. If you have a drive set up as the TM backup drive, you cannot designate another drive as the backup drive unless you disable the existing backup drive. TM cannot backup to more than one drive at a time, and TM cannot span backups across multiple drives.
    To move any device out of the Exclude list simply select it then click on the [-] button to remove it from the list.
    To prepare a new drive as the backup drive you must partition the drive GUID or APM depending upon whether your computer is Intel or PPC, respectively, and the formatted Mac OS Extended (Journaled.) See the following:
    Extended Hard Drive Preparation
    1. Open Disk Utility in your Utilities folder. If you need to reformat your startup volume, then you must boot from your OS X Installer Disc. After the installer loads select your language and click on the Continue button. When the menu bar appears select Disk Utility from the Installer menu (Utilities menu for Tiger or Leopard.)
    2. After DU loads select your hard drive (this is the entry with the mfgr.'s ID and size) from the left side list. Note the SMART status of the drive in DU's status area. If it does not say "Verified" then the drive is failing or has failed and will need replacing. SMART info will not be reported on external drives. Otherwise, click on the Partition tab in the DU main window.
    3. Set the number of partitions from the dropdown menu (use 1 partition unless you wish to make more.) Set the format type to Mac OS Extended (Journaled.) Click on the Options button, set the partition scheme to GUID (only required for Intel Macs) then click on the OK button. Click on the Partition button and wait until the volume(s) mount on the Desktop.
    4. Select the volume you just created (this is the sub-entry under the drive entry) from the left side list. Click on the Erase tab in the DU main window.
    5. Set the format type to Mac OS Extended (Journaled.) Click on the Options button, check the button for Zero Data and click on OK to return to the Erase window.
    6. Click on the Erase button. The format process can take up to several hours depending upon the drive size.
    Steps 4-6 are optional but should be used on a drive that has never been formatted before, if the format type is not Mac OS Extended, if the partition scheme has been changed, or if a different operating system (not OS X) has been installed on the drive.

  • How do I back up my entire iphoto library to an external hard drive that I have dedicated for photos only?  Can I simply drag the iphoto library onto my seagate (hard drive) icon?

    How do I back up my entire iphoto library on to an external hard drive that will be my second back up plan.  I already have one back up that is also synched with time machine.  But now I want to back up my iphoto library to a new hard drive to have a second copy. Can I simply drag the whole library onto the icon on my desk top?  THX

    WHile you can do it that way, the next time you back up you'll end up copying the entire library again, and,as you'l see, once a library gets bigger that can take a considerable amount of time.
    Try using an app that will do incremental back ups. This is a very good way to work. The first time you run the back up the app will make a complete copy of the Library. Thereafter it will update the back up with the changes you have made. That makes subsequent back ups much faster. Many of these apps also have scheduling capabilities: So set it up and it will do the back up automatically.
    Example of such apps: Chronosync - but there are many others. Search on MacUpdate or the App Store
